Person shot by Chicago cop in Hyde Park

Authorities are investigating after a Chicago police officer shot a suspected burglar at a neighbor’s home Aug. 21, 2019, in the 5100 block of South Ingleside Avenue. | Civilian Office of Police Accountability

A Chicago police officer shot someone Wednesday in Hyde Park on the South Side.

The officer shot someone while intervening in a possible burglary at a neighbor’s home about 12:30 p.m. in the 5100 block of South Ingleside Avenue, according to Chicago police spokesman Anthony Guglielmi.

The suspected burglar left the area but has not showed up at any hospitals, Guglielmi said.

The Civilian Office of Police Accountability responded to the scene to investigate the shooting.
